Subject: 1. What is Stars! (very brief)

Stars! is a computer strategy game for the Windows platform. If you want
to learn more about this game, or if you want to download a playable demo
version, visit the Stars! WWW page:

<http://www.webmap.com/stars!>
OR
<http://www.webmap.com/stars%21>

The above site also offers many other resources, including a comprehensive
FAQ, links to other Stars! WWW sites, and reviews of the game.

Subject: 2. Newsgroup Charter

CHARTER: rec.games.computer.stars

This newsgroup is a forum for the discussion of the strategy game
"Stars!", written by Jeff Johnson and Jeff McBride. This newsgroup
will not be moderated. Acceptable postings to this newsgroup include:

* Announcements of new "Stars!" games requiring players, or
existing "Stars!" games in which replacement players are needed

As a courtesy to readers, these announcements should begin with
the key word GAME: at the beginning of the subject line. The
key word REPLACE: should be used if replacements for an
existing game are sought.

Games in which players are required to pay a fee for
participating should clearly indicate this in the game
announcement. Postings that do not announce the beginning of a
new pay-for-play game but instead advertise the pay-for-play
service itself fall under the category of 'commercial services'
and will be governed by the rules regarding advertisements
below.

* Strategies for playing the game

* Tips and questions regarding the game mechanics

* Suggestions for future versions of the game

* Information on new releases, upgrades, patches, etc. from the
game authors

* Direct comparison of "Stars!" and other strategy games in the
same genre

* Announcements of commercial or shareware programs or services
that are directly related to "Stars!"

These postings must be concise and informative, must contain a
minimum of hype, and no more than 1 advertisement per month for
a single product or service is allowed.

All advertisements should be marked with the key word AD: or
ADVERTISEMENT: at the beginning of the subject line.

* Announcements of free programs or services directly related to
"Stars!"

These postings are not considered advertisements but should
nonetheless be governed by common sense and restraint in the
nature of the announcement and the frequency of posting.

It is suggested that such posts be marked with the key word
ANNOUNCE: at the beginning of the subject line.

All forms of advertisement other than those covered above are
considered UNACCEPTABLE for posting to this newsgroup.

Postings containing binary files (regardless of encoding) are
UNACCEPTABLE for this newsgroup. Rather than posting a binary
file, the binary file should be placed at an appropriate FTP site
(such as the /pub directory of beast.webmap.com, which is the
main "Stars!" FTP server) or posted to alt.binaries.games or
alt.binaries.misc and a pointer to the binary file's location posted
to this newsgroup.

Subject: 3. Nomenclature

Here is a list of terms that you may encounter in newsgroup discussion.
Please contact the current maintainer for changes or additions to this
list. Thanks to Kent Peterson for getting this started. A larger set
of acronyms is available online at:

<http://www.grigzy.com/mysteryguild/strat/abriv.htm>

Racial Acronyms
---------------

IT - Inter-stellar Traveller
IS - Inner-Strength (note that one should be careful when using
IS to mean Inner-Strength and *not* Inter-stellar Traveller)
SS - Super-Stealth
WM - War Monger
JOAT - Jack of All Trades
CA - Claim Adjuster
AR - Alternate Reality
SD - Space Demolition
HE - Hyper-Expansion
PP - Packet Physics
HP - Hyper-Producer (a race design for high resource output)
HG - Hyper-Growth (a race design for high population growth)

General Game Terms
------------------

PRT - Primary Racial Trait (e.g., Super Stealth, Alternate Reality)
LRT - Lesser Racial Trait (e.g., Improved Starbases, Total Terraforming)

Ship Acronyms
-------------

BB - Battleship
CA - Cruiser (CA is also used for Claim Adjuster, perhaps CC is better)
DD - Destroyer

Other Terms
-----------

PBEM - Play-by-E-Mail
MM - Micro-management

Subject: 4. Other Stars! Resources

* If you want to join in a play-by-email game, the best place to read
about new game announcements is the Stars! Player Mailing List
(S!PML) which is maintained by Trevor Scallen and Mathias Dellaert
(formerly maintained by Alan Beall at the Stars! Depot). The S!PML has
a huge number of active subscribers. You can subscribe or unsubscribe
directly at:

<http://www.grigzy.com/mysteryguild> (The Mystery Guild)

* If you don't have time to read this newsgroup, subscribe to Andrew Sterian's
Stars! Announcements list. This is a low-volume list consisting mainly of
announcements of new Stars! versions, new auxilliary programs that aid
in playing/hosting Stars!, and other significant postings culled from the
rec.games.computer.stars newsgroup. To subscribe, send e-mail with the
single word SUBSCRIBE in the SUBJECT line (and spell it right!) to:
